This fires when a Quillon build target produces different artifact hashes between the legacy Makefile path and the new hermetic Fennel build system. During the migration window both systems run in parallel, and any divergence means an undeclared dependency is leaking into the hermetic build — usually a system header or environment variable. Do not suppress this alert; divergences compound quickly. Record the affected target and the differing hash pair. The triage checklist and known-cause table live on the page below.

operations page: https://confluence.qorvellabs.internal/pages/projects/projects/projects

# Watchdog settings for the Tillamane kiosk app.
# The watchdog pings the UI process every 8 seconds and restarts it after
# three consecutive misses. Please review the backoff carefully: we use
# exponential backoff capped at 5 minutes so a crash loop on bad hardware
# doesn't hammer the device. Every restart event is recorded with a reason
# code so field techs at Dorval Systems can triage remotely. The event
# recorder persists to the database specified on the following line.

replica DSN, yahaf-yagaf: mongodb://tamath_svc:a2netSk3RZMuTj@db-d084.novacsoft.internal:5432/ralmir

To: Dispatch Desk (attn: driver coordination)
Subject: Spare parts run — Kestrel Flats pump station

The crate of Dravold impeller seals and bearing kits for the Kestrel Flats site is packed and weatherproofed at our Ullsmere workshop. Please assign a driver familiar with the gravel access road; the final kilometre is unsigned. The parts are urgently needed, so schedule the run for tomorrow morning with a confirmed departure time. The confidential hand-over instruction for the courier follows immediately below.

courier memo of fahag-badug: the norys istion courier leaves the zoriel ledger at gate 4000 under passcode 457370